from the Encrapstore website regarding GreenDragon

No Oxi..Green Dragon is not a traditional encap product and does not contain polymers. Instead, the product utilizes anti-redeposition agents that help repel soil from the fiber.


Google tells me antiredesposition agents are;

ANTIREDEPOSITION AGENT: An ingredient used in laundry detergents to help prevent soil from resettling on fabrics after it has been removed during washing.


I'm not a vury smart man..
so how would that be useful for bonnet cleaning?
...If you actually want soil to transfer to the bonnet? :headscratch:
